Love Locks
A red regional train passes over the Hohenzollern Bridge as two women walk past thousands of love padlocks attached to the fence in Cologne, North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any, on May 21, 2022. The bridge is a popular spot for couples who attach padlocks to symbolize their love and throw the key into the Rhine River below. (Photo by Michael Nguyen/NurPhoto) -

Zizkov Television Tower In Prague
Zizkov Television Tower stands prominently above the surrounding residential area in Prague, Czech Republic, on May 11, 2025. The high-tech structure, known for its unusual pod design and climbing baby sculptures by artist David Cerny, functions as a broadcasting tower and observation point. Bologna Shoah Memorial
A view of the twin steel monoliths of the Bologna Shoah Memorial in Bologna, Emilia-Romagna, Italy, on November 11, 2021. The memorial, inaugurated in 2016 near Bologna Central Station, honors the memory of Jewish victims deported from the city during the Holocaust. (Photo by Michael Nguyen/NurPhoto) -

Mono Print
The Post Office Television Control Centre in London came into being when it was decided to extend the BBC Television Service to the Provinces. The function of the Centre is to operate and control the complex network of Post Office Cables and radio links used to distribute the TV programmes.
Now equipment is being installed to connect the studios of the Programme Companies, switching centres and the ITA transmitters and will be used to link up with the ITA tranmitters in the North. The London - Birmingham radio link is being modified to form the first link to the ITA transmitters in the North.
Picture shows: The Paraboloid aerial which is to be used for beaming the ITA programmes to Birmingham and the Midlands, on the roof of the Television Centrol Centre.
